Pittsburgh Pirates @ St. Louis Cardinals

1933-06-14 Β· Day game Β· Sportsman's Park III Β· Att: 2400 Β· 1:54

St. Louis Cardinals defeated Pittsburgh Pirates 3–2. Bill Hallahan earned the win. George Watkins went 1-for-4 with 1 HR and 1 RBI.
